Consonants by Barbara Gregorich is an engaging early reader designed for children ages 5-8, helping them understand the role of consonants in language through simple, accessible fiction. This book supports foundational literacy skills appropriate for Grade 2 reading levels, with no concerning content to note.
Why we rated Consonants 7C
Consonants is written at a Level 2 reading level across 32 pages. Strong independent readers around grade 3.0 can typically handle this book on their own; with parent or teacher support, Consonants works for readers up to grade 4.0.
We rate Consonants as 7C ("Clear") because the content sits in the "Gentle" range — no conflict beyond everyday childhood experiences. Across our four dimensions (emotional, physical, social, thematic) the book reads as evenly gentle; no single dimension stands out as a concern.
No specific content flags were raised by community reviewers, which is consistent with the gentle intensity score.
Thematically, Consonants explores early literacy, language learning, children: grades 2-3, and fiction — these threads give the book room to mean different things to different readers.
